The red wine Mount Athos, vintage 2009 from the winery Tsantali has been rated in 2014 by Axel Biesler und Marco Lindauer with 87 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the region Macedonia in Greece.

Tasting Notes

87
Tasting from 15.07.2014: Axel Biesler und Marco Lindauer

Strong ruby garnet, violet reflections, broad rim brightening. Delicate red berry underlaid fresh herbal spice, tobacco nuances, mineral notes. Medium body, red berry fruit, present tannins, delicate bitter chocolate on the finish, a spicy food companion.
